A healthcare recruitment agency is seeking a Physiotherapist in Southampton for a community-based role. You will deliver one-to-one physiotherapy in patients' homes, facilitating recovery and promoting independence.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Conducting assessments
  • Formulating treatment plans
  • Educating patients on mobility equipment

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Community experience
  • HCPC registration
  • A full UK driving licence

This position offers a competitive salary starting from £32,000, a company car allowance, and generous annual leave.

How to prepare for a job interview at Four Leaf Recruitment

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your physiotherapy knowledge, especially in community settings. Be ready to discuss specific assessment techniques and treatment plans you've used in the past. This shows you're not just qualified but also experienced.

✨Showcase Your Communication Skills

Since you'll be working one-on-one with patients, it's crucial to demonstrate your ability to communicate effectively. Prepare examples of how you've educated patients about their treatment or mobility equipment in a clear and supportive manner.

✨Highlight Your Community Experience

Be prepared to talk about your previous roles in community care. Share specific instances where you helped patients regain independence or improved their quality of life. This will help the interviewer see how you fit into their community-focused approach.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ions that show your interest in the role and the company. Inquire about their approach to patient care or how they support their physiotherapists in the field. This demonstrates your enthusiasm and commitment to the position.
